    摘要: Vehicles, systems, and methods for determining a distance travelled are provided. In an exemplary embodiment, a vehicle includes an electric motor with a motor rotor shaft. A motor resolver is positioned adjacent to the motor rotor shaft, where the motor resolver is configured to determine a motor position of the electric motor based on revolutions of the motor rotor shaft. A controller is in communication with the motor resolver, where the controller is configured to determine a distance travelled from a change in the electric motor position.

    摘要: A travel distance measurement device includes a transmitting antenna that is disposed in a vehicle and emits a transmission signal, as a radio wave, toward a ground surface, a receiving antenna that is disposed in the vicinity of the transmitting antenna, and receives a radio wave reflected from the ground surface and acquires a reflection signal, and a distance calculator (an IQ demodulator and a phase conversion integrator) that calculates the travel distance of the vehicle on the basis of the phase of the acquired reflection signal.

    摘要: A vehicle control system includes a computer and logic executable by the computer. The logic is configured to read an odometer value from a storage system. The odometer value corresponds to an accrued mileage obtained from an odometer. The accrued mileage is determined at a beginning of a current driving event. The logic is also configured to read an odometer value for the vehicle from another storage system. The odometer value from the other storage system corresponds to an accrued mileage obtained from the storage system at the beginning of a driving event that precedes the current driving event. The logic is further configured to compare the odometer value from the storage system to the odometer value from the other storage system and calculate a reduction value from the difference, upon determining the odometer value from the other storage system is greater than the odometer value from the storage system.

    摘要: Apparatus and methods for calibrating dynamic parameters of a vehicle navigation system are presented. One method may include determining whether reference position data of a vehicle is available, and measuring composite accelerations of the vehicle. The method may further include generating distance and turn angle data based upon a wheel speed sensors data, computing distance and turn angle errors based upon the independent position data, and associating the distance and turn angle errors with composite accelerations. A second method presented includes calibrating an inertial navigation sensor within a vehicle navigation system. The second method may include determining reference position data and Inertial Navigation System (INS) data, aligning an IMU with the vehicle, and aligning the IMU with an Earth fixed coordinate system. The second method may further include computing the vehicle alignment with respect to a horizontal plane, and determining calibration parameters for distance sensors associated with the vehicle.

    摘要: A display system is provided for a trailer equipped with an electronic braking system (EBS) and/or an anti-lock braking system (ABS). A separate display device having a display is provided for indicating at least the mileage on the trailer vehicle. In order to reduce the amount of wiring required, a speed signal of at least one of the wheels of the trailer is looped through the EBS/ABS and is routed directly to the display device.
